如何在v2ray中启用sniffing流量探测

如何在v2ray中启用sniffing流量探测

目录

什么是v2ray?

sniffing流量探测的概念

为什么需要启用sniffing?

启用sniffing的步骤

4.1 安装v2ray

4.2 修改配置文件

4.3 重启服务

sniffing流量探测的配置示例

常见问题解答

总结

1. 什么是v2ray?

v2ray是一款强大的网络代理工具,旨在帮助用户突破网络限制,实现更为自由的上网体验。其功能丰富,不仅支持多种传输协议,还能进行流量加密和混淆,保障用户的隐私与安全。

2. sniffing流量探测的概念

sniffing流量探测是一种分析和识别网络流量的技术,能够监控经过网络的数据包。这项技术广泛应用于网络安全、性能优化以及流量管理等领域。对于v2ray而言,启用sniffing能够帮助识别流量类型,从而实现更加智能的流量转发和策略配置。

3. 为什么需要启用sniffing?

启用sniffing具有以下优势:

流量管理:通过识别流量类型,v2ray能够有效管理网络资源。

提高性能:可以根据流量类型优化路由,提高数据传输效率。

安全监控:及时识别可疑流量,有助于增强网络安全性。

支持复杂场景:在复杂网络环境下,sniffing可以提供更为灵活的解决方案。

4. 启用sniffing的步骤

4.1 安装v2ray

确保已经安装v2ray,您可以访问官方网站进行下载和安装。

4.2 修改配置文件

找到v2ray的配置文件,一般为config.json,在其中加入sniffing配置。

以下是一个示例配置:

{ “outbounds”: [ { “protocol”: “vmess”, “settings”: { “vnext”: [ { “address”: “server_address”, “port”: server_port, “users”: [ { “id”: “user_id”, “alterId”: alter_id } ] } ] }, “sniff”: { “enabled”: true, “destOverride”: [“http”, “tls”] } } ] }

4.3 重启服务

完成配置后,重启v2ray服务以使更改生效。使用命令: bash systemctl restart v2ray

5. sniffing流量探测的配置示例

在config.json中,可以根据实际需求调整sniffing设置,以下是几个配置示例:

只监测特定流量:可以通过destOverride参数限制监测类型。

设置多种代理方式:可以配置多条outbounds以满足不同流量需求。

6. 常见问题解答

Q1: v2ray如何进行sniffing流量探测?

A: 在v2ray的配置文件中,将sniff设置为true并指定监测类型即可。

Q2: sniffing会影响网络速度吗?

A: 正确配置的sniffing应该不会对网络速度产生明显影响,反而能够通过智能路由提高传输效率。

Q3: 可以通过sniffing识别所有流量类型吗?

A: 大多数常见协议可以被识别,但某些加密流量可能无法被有效识别。

Q4: 如何验证sniffing是否生效?

A: 可以查看v2ray的日志文件,确认sniffing功能是否正常工作。

7. 总结

启用sniffing流量探测是v2ray的一项重要功能,它能够提升流量管理能力,保障网络安全。通过本文的步骤与示例,用户可以快速掌握sniffing的设置方法,提升使用v2ray的体验。如果您有任何问题,请随时查阅常见问题部分,或参考官方文档。

评论留言